42, Gotch Road, Kettering is recorded publicly as a mid-century freehold house across 602 ft2 of internal area, sitting on a 428 m2 plot.
Locally, houses of this size norm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Our estimate of the sale value of 42, Gotch Road, Kettering is £236,799 and its rental estimate is £1,122 per month, given the available information and assuming reasonable condition.

The condition of a property plays an important role in determining its value, with the degree of impact varying by property type, size and location.
For 42, Gotch Road, Kettering, we estimate a market value of £248,639 and a rental value of £1,178 per month when presented in very good decorative order. Should the property require extensive cosmetic improvement, those figures would reduce to £220,223 and £1,044 per month respectively.
Over the last year, 42, Gotch Road, Kettering has seen its estimated sale value move down by £2,861 (1.2%) and its estimated rental value increase by £14 per month (1.2%). This results in an estimated gross rental yield of 5.7%.
HM Land Registry records the plot of land for 42, Gotch Road, Kettering as measuring 428 m2.
That makes it the 4th largest plot in the postcode, where 47 of the 50 other houses have recorded plot data.
42, Gotch Road, Kettering has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 10 May 2023.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
The most recent sale of 42, Gotch Road, Kettering completed on 9th October 2023 at £250,000 and was recorded by HM Land Registry as a freehold house.
Since 1995 the property has sold twice.
